Find the length of an arc when the radius is 15 feet and the measure of the central angle 135 degrees. Round to nearest hundredt

h.
Mathematics
1 answer:
balu736 [363]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

35.34

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ula for arc length is 2rФπ/360

2(15)(135)=4050

4050/360·π=35.34

You borrow bookcases to display 943 books. You plan to put 22 books on each shelf. There are 5 shelves. How many bookcases do yo
zaharov [31]

Answer:

9 bookcases.

Step-by-step explanation:

Total number of books = 943

Total number of books placed in one shelf = 22

Total number of shelves in one bookcase = 5

Total number of books displayed in one bookcase = No.\ of\ shelves\ in\ 1\ bookcase\times\ No.\ of\ books\ in\ each\ shelf

Total number of books displayed in one bookcase= 5\times 22=110

Total number of bookcase required = \frac{total\ no.\ of\ books}{Number\ of\ books\ displayed\ in\ 1\ bookcase}

Total number  of bookcase required = \frac{943}{110} =8\frac{63}{110}

So, 880 books can be displayed in 8 bookcases. and for the remaining 63 books we also require one more bookcase. Therefore, the total number of bookcases needed are 9.
